Learning Mentor job summary
Learning Mentor / Teaching Assistant
Grade 3, Point 5 FTE £25,583.00 pa pro rata
30 hours per week, Monday to Friday 8:45am – 3:15pm
Term-time only
Fixed Term Contract – 1 September 2026 – 31 August 2027
Closing Date is 8 July 2026
Interviews to be held TBC
This is a fantastic opportunity for a Learning Mentor / Teaching Assistant to join our school, working alongside a highly skilled Additional Educational Needs team, supporting our students. This role will inspire, challenge and drive you to develop, alongside professionals, the highest standards of education and care, making a difference to the lives of our young people.
Your role will involve working closely with class teachers to ensure students are able to fully participate in the mainstream classroom curriculum. The work is varied and will include in-class support, small group work and you will be required to assist with school break and/or lunchtime duties.
Ideally (but not essentially) you will have previous experience working with children, young people or adults with specific additional learning needs. Equally as important, however, are the ‘softer’ skills needed to engage, inspire and encourage our young people to achieve their very best.
We welcome applications from those wishing to apply for the maximum number of hours (30) as well as those wishing to apply on reduced hours to fit around other commitments, for example dropping off or picking up children from school. If you would like to apply on this basis and are shortlisted, pleased discuss this at interview.
Ralph Allen is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children: the successful applicant must be willing to undergo child protection screening appropriate to the post including checks with past employers and will need to undertake an enhanced criminal record check via the DBS.
